What's Happening?
Bedrock Robotics Inc., a company specializing in autonomous construction equipment, has raised $270 million in Series B funding, bringing its total funding to over $350 million. This investment will accelerate the development of operator-less excavators, aiming to transform construction practices by deploying autonomous machines and connected fleets. The company, which emerged from stealth in July 2025, is working towards its first fully operator-less deployments later this year. The funding round was led by CapitalG and the Valor Atreides AI Fund, with participation from several other investors, including NVIDIA's venture capital arm. Bedrock plans to use the funds to enhance its technology, expand its team, and increase its geographical footprint.
Why It's Important?
The advancement of autonomous construction equipment by Bedrock Robotics represents a significant shift in the construction industry, which faces a growing demand for infrastructure development and a shortage of skilled labor. By automating tasks traditionally performed by human operators, Bedrock aims to improve productivity and safety on construction sites. This innovation could lead to cost savings and efficiency gains for contractors, potentially reshaping the industry's labor dynamics. The successful deployment of operator-less excavators could also pave the way for broader adoption of autonomous technologies in other sectors, further driving the integration of AI and robotics in everyday operations.
What's Next?
Bedrock Robotics plans to deploy its first operator-less excavators later this year, marking a milestone in autonomous construction technology. The company will focus on solidifying the robustness and versatility of its systems, with a long-term goal of scaling its capabilities and volume. As the technology matures, Bedrock aims to become a major ecosystem provider, leveraging existing networks to manage and deploy autonomous machines. The company is also expanding its leadership team to support its growth and development efforts, positioning itself to capitalize on the increasing demand for autonomous solutions in the construction industry.
